The results of a comparative study of the sensitivity of several methods for mycoplasma detection in cell cultures are presented. The most sensitive method was found to be that of electron microscopy detecting mycoplasmal contamination in 100% preparations. Seeding of the material on mycoplasma-elective nutrient medium (0.3% PPLO agar) and the method of autoradiography detect the culture contamination in 90% of the test materials. Staining of cell cultures with orsein and Schiff reagent are less sensitive methods revealing mycoplasmal contamination in 69% and 77.7% of the cultures, respectively.
